Assessments
Morelle made documented same-term efforts on the childcare-access promise, including publicly supporting federal legislation to lower childcare costs and expand access for working families and intervening with HHS over frozen childcare and family assistance funds. However, the cited legislation had not been enacted, and the broader 2024 CCDF access improvements were federal administrative action not clearly attributable to Morelle. That supports credit for material effort and issue advocacy, but not full delivery of the promised outcome.
The evidence shows Morelle made and continued to pursue the promise, including supporting childcare-access legislation and opposing a freeze on childcare and family assistance funds. However, the record provided does not show that expanded childcare access for working families was actually enacted or delivered as an outcome.
